M24望远镜,是美军的制式镜,和美军的M22制式镜不同,M24镜子很小个头,突出了便携性。小得可以放到外衣口袋里。该产品最初由日本富士公司生产。
我们出售的产品和日本货一模一样,上面有产品型号,和NSN编码,和日镜的差异有两点,一没有在镜体上安装激光防护膜,因为这个产品是由美方承包商采购,可能最终是供应其军队或仆从国军队,所以激光防护膜没有在中国加工和安装以保证订货国的保密及安全问题。二目镜罩是橡胶的,美JUN的则是硬质塑料盖板。在其它方面是一致的。
该产品由中国云南专业作军用望远镜出口的工厂为国外生产,用于恶劣环境下工作使用,镜子内部采用高强度铝合金制造,外包橡胶。这样的好处是由于内部为全金属不会产生碰撞导致的光轴偏移,这个是普通的低价望远镜不可比拟的。
该产品有NSN编号,但是最终是否供应给美国JUN方不清楚,但是该产品按照美JUN标生产并验收。可以达到JUN用品的标准。
望远镜左侧的镜筒内有内置的分划板可以作简易的测距。分划板上面有国际标准的密位线,可以进行概略的测距和角度测量。或者在已经知道距离时,大概测出目标的高宽。
镜体内置有干躁仓,内置干躁剂可以有效的防止发霉起雾。
该产品的镜片品质优秀,加上光路为日本工程师设计,所以镜子的成像清晰锐利。
技术指标:
放大倍率: 7倍
物镜直径: 28毫米
出瞳直径: 4毫米
出瞳距离: 15毫米
棱镜类型:屋脊棱镜
镜体材料:航空铝合金
重量: 410克
视角: 7°,
1,000码视场:367英尺
光学透过率: 90%
内充氮气,防水防雾。
左侧目镜内有测距分划线
调焦系统:左右眼独立调焦

NORMAL OPERATION
(1) Place neck strap about your neck.
(2) Remove eye-lens cover by first rotating binocular
telescopes inward and then lifting off eye-lens cover.
(3) Unsnap objective covers from front of binocular
and let them hang down from binocular.
(4) Rotate the telescopes of the binocular about the
center hinge until both circular fields of view have
merged into one.
(5) Rotate the pop down eyecups to obtain the
proper diopter settings on the diopter scale .
(6) When sighting through the binocular, hold it in a comfortable and stable position.
(7) Refer to pages 11 and 12 for precautions to be observed when unusual weather or
atmosphere conditions prevail.
(8)Under the special conditions when direct sunlight enters the binocular a portion of
this light will be reflected back producing a glint effect which may be detectable at
positions in the general target field.
USE OF RETICLE
One of the telescopes of the binocular includes a horizontal and vertical scale reticle
graduated in 10 mil increment unit markings (1 unit - 10 mils, 2 units - 20 mils, etc.)
Fire corrections can be made by viewing the impact area and determining angular
corrections by use of the left or right horizontal reticle scale.
USE OF RETICLE
In determining range, if an object fills one 10 mil unit marking on the horizontal retie
scale and is known to be 10 meters wide, the object is 1000 meters away. If the same size
object fills two unit markings (20 mils), it would be 500 meters away. When this formula is
used, the distance will be given in the same units of measurement (feet, meters, etc.) as is
used in estimating the known size of the object. The same formula can be used to determine
range with the vertical reticle scale when the height of an object is known. The use of the
vertical scale is preferred (especially on level terrain), since objects are often viewed obliquely
along the horizontal axis.
